Cancer Of The Breast

A high killer of women, cancer of the breast is really a sickness that manifests itself inside the tissues of a woman's breast. If it's discovered early, cancer of the breast is actually treatable. Nevertheless, if not treated until its later stages, it can be lethal. Gynecologists in Miami and also the rest of the US will certainly suggest a yearly mammogram beginning at the age of 40 years; if you are of higher risk due to heredity or lifestyle, he or she may request that you begin them early. Cervical Cancer

The cervix is located in the lower part of the uterus and opens to the vaginal area. Cancer of this area is known as cervical cancer and is the 2nd top killer of females on the planet regarding disease. The precursor to cervical cancer is a condition known as dysplasia. This problem can be noticed in the pap smear and is simple to treat as well as eliminate. Once this precancerous condition evolves into cervical cancer, it can spread to the bladder, intestines, liver, and lungs. A yearly gynecologist consultation is of vital importance since early diagnosis is essential to surviving this disease.

Ovarian Cancer

Most frequent in menopausal as well as post menopausal women, ovarian cancer is practically undetected until the signs or symptoms appear in the later stages. These signs or symptoms include things like abdominal and pelvic pain, swelling in the abdominal and pelvic areas, frequent urination along with changes in bowel activity, post menopausal bleeding, and even fatigue. Since this disease is difficult to identify without an ultrasound examination, it is very important that you simply communicate in detail with your gynecologist regarding any unusual signs or symptoms you might be experiencing. If you have a history of ovarian cancer in your background, your physician might schedule regular ultrasounds to be proactive.
